"You know how it is — you say the same words, yet they mean different things to those hearing them. you offer the same touch, yet it yields different results in different lives. Some people soak up your touch; others wipe it off. You might look at these situations and get discouraged: "Fine! I just won't do anything nice for anyone!" Yet look back at the example of Jesus."
— Amy Nappa
